Municipal Income Strategy
The strategy seeks total return as well as current income exempt from federal income tax. It invests in a diversified portfolio of primarily intermediate- to long-term municipal obligations that are investment-grade or above. It allows up to 25% in taxable municipals. The objective is to outperform the Bloomberg Municipal Bond Index by actively managing the four key elements of total return: security selection, sector rotation, duration management, and yield-curve positioning.
